Minister launches new agricultural machine
Development in the agriculture sphere depends on the introduction of advanced and modern technologies to the local agriculture sector which in turn will lead to self sufficiency and boost the economy, Agriculture Development Minister Hema Kumara Nanayakkara said yesterday.
He said the local agriculture sector will do better by employing indigenous technologies rather than opting for costly methods adopted by developed countries .
Addressing the media at the Agriculture and Agrarian Services Ministry Auditorium after introducing the paddy sowing machine (paddy seeder) "Hansamack" manufactured by Hansa Industries, Minister Nanayakkara said the new machine would help cut down on the huge overhead costs on agriculture production.
Under the Api Wawamu Rata Nagamu national concept such new inventions of technologies will help the farming community, Minister Nanayakkara added.
